We’re working in partnership with a leading Tier 1 contractor delivering a major Ministry of Defence (MoD) redevelopment project at Marne Barracks, Catterick Garrison. We’re now looking to appoint an experienced Quantity Surveyor to support the commercial delivery of this long-term, multi-phase scheme.

The project forms part of the MoD’s Defence Estate Optimisation (DEO) Programme and will run through to 2027, delivering new accommodation, sports facilities and supporting infrastructure within a live, secure military environment.


The Project

The works include multiple new-build and refurbishment packages, such as:

  • New accommodation blocks (170+ bedrooms)
  • Gymnasium and strength & conditioning facilities
  • Workshops, garages and storage buildings
  • Roads, car parking, pedestrian and cycle routes
  • Landscaping and external works

The scheme is currently progressing through RIBA Stages 3 & 4, with enabling works underway and main construction phases commenced from mid-2025.


The Role

As Quantity Surveyor, you’ll provide full commercial support to live construction packages, working closely with the site team and client representatives to maintain cost control, manage change and ensure strong financial performance.

You’ll be embedded on the project, supporting delivery from pre-construction through to final account within a highly governed and compliance-driven environ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Maintain accurate cost, value and cashflow reporting
  • Produce forecasts, CVRs and commercial reports
  • Administer the main contract and manage change control (typically NEC-based)
  • Manage subcontract procurement, negotiation and financial performance
  • Prepare and agree applications for payment
  • Manage variations, compensation events and final accounts
  • Work closely with site teams to forecast spend and cash recovery
  • Liaise with the client and wider project team on commercial matters
